In average, 85% of full-time first-time beginning undergraduate students (freshmen) have received grants and/or scholarships at Most Searched Technical Colleges In Montana. The average financial aid amount received is $8,867.
For all undergraduate students, 78.13% received grants/scholarship and the average aid amount is $7,846
The average tuition & fees for the schools is $6,991 for state residents and $20,310 for out-of-state students.
The average cost of attendance (COA) including tuition & fees, book & supplies, and living costs for Most Searched Technical Colleges In Montana is $34,598 and, after receiving financial aid, the actual cost is down to $25,731.
